Islamabad: Pakistan and Bahrain on Wednesday agreed to further enhance bilateral relations by activating institutional cooperation through early convening of BPC and JMC.
It was agreed in a telephonic conversation between Foreign Minister Mohammad Ishaq Dar and his Bahrain counterpart Dr. Abdullatif bin Rashid Al Zayani today.
Both discussed the entire gamut of Pakistan-Bahrain relations and explored various aspects of enhancing mutually beneficial cooperation.
